I truly cannot say enough good things about Naticook Veterinary Hospital. We had transferred to Naticook in the summer of 2021 when we realized that most of the veterinary techs we’ve loved over the years as well as Dr. Whitebone were there. We had a vet we had used for a couple of years that left a practice we were at and we had a hard time feeling like we had a vet that truly knew our dog. When we switched to Naticook we had been monitoring our dog for some elevated liver and gallbladder levels that the prior vet had been treating with a medication. Upon examination and review of her records, the wonderful staff at Naticook suggested that we do an ultrasound out of an abundance of caution and to be sure we weren’t overlooking anything. The ultrasound revealed a 6cm tumor in our dog’s liver. Dr. Whitebone presented every option, and truly supported us through making the decision to go to Mass Vet. While we ultimately had to say goodbye to our dog, we are so grateful for the diagnosis that came from Naticook that allowed us to make our dog’s last months truly memorable, to give her a fighting chance and to say goodbye in a compassionate way. When we were ready to open our hearts and home to a new rescue, the folks at Naticook were the first people I called. They absolutely love our Pitbull! Our dog is dog aggressive and the staff at Naticook go out of their way to ensure the safety of everyone, including Isabella. They never make us feel like we’re putting them out to check in from the parking lot, and they’re great with bringing us right into a room so we don’t have to worry about other dogs. Isabella absolutely loves the staff there and even gives Dr. Whitebone hugs. Honestly each and every person there is absolutely fantastic, from the staff when you check in to each vet tech that just absolutely loves on our dog. Whenever anyone asks for recommendations for a vet in the area I will always pass along Naticook Vet. They are amazingly caring and...

I’ve been coming to Naticook for about 7 years now since my oldest cat became a patient with Dr. Whitebone. He is hands down the best vet I’ve ever been to. Factual, transparent, caring, and kind. At the time I came to the practice, my cat was so sick and I went to 2 other practices in the Nashua area that offered me no information, had me pay for tests and procedures that didn't help, and had no clue as to how to help him after all of it. My friend recommended Dr. Whitebone as my last resort and when I went he knew immediately what was wrong, bloodwork confirmed it, and he saved my cats life. I’ve since added two more cats and now a dog to the list of patients there. My female cat was also seriously sick in 2022 and instead of pushing me into a $1500 surgery right away Dr. Whitebone gave a different option to try first, gave thorough follow-up, saved her from a massive surgery, and me from the cost. I will never go to another vet in the area again. The pricing is fair, they never push you or make you feel like a bad pet parent for not opting for more expensive procedures if they aren’t necessary, and they always let the routine stuff be your choice. The techs are all nice, charismatic, and chatty. I love the addition of Dr. Waples to the practice too! She’s an amazing vet and makes you feel...
